Cells that line blood vessels created

Thursday, August 22, 2013 - 20:00 in Biology & Nature

In a scientific first, scientists have successfully grown the cells that line the blood vessels -- called vascular endothelial cells -- from human induced pluripotent stem cells, revealing new details about how these cells function.
